Overview
The FMOS1846BB's most notable attribute is 1500W of output power combined with a 1.8 cu ft interior at $299. That combination, high wattage, large interior, accessible price, is competitive. Frigidaire's OTR lineup has earned a solid reputation across its FFMV series, and the 4.4-star rating from 42 buyers suggests this specific model continues that trend.
The defining constraint is width: at 20 inches, this unit is designed for a compact or non-standard kitchen space rather than the 29.75-30 inch cutout that dominates OTR installations. The overall dimensions of 33 x 20 x 19 inches confirm a taller-than-typical profile as well. Buyers with a 20-inch range will find this one of very few high-spec options available; buyers with a 30-inch range should not purchase this unit.
With 10 power levels and a black color, it suits kitchens with black appliance suites. Controls information is not listed, which is a minor gap in the published specs. At 61 lb, installation weight is standard for a microwave with this power output. Frigidaire's service network is one of the strongest in the US, which is a meaningful consideration at any price point.

Performance notes
At 1500W, this unit heats 50% faster than standard 1000W OTR models. The 1.8 cu ft interior handles large casserole dishes and full dinner plates without difficulty. Ten power levels provide adequate control range for defrost and variable heating tasks. The 120V power supply is standard. Dimensions of 33 x 20 x 19 inches reflect a compact-width but tall-and-deep unit, verify ceiling, cabinet, and depth clearances before ordering. This is not a drop-in replacement for a standard 30-inch OTR installation.

Is the Frigidaire FMOS1846BB a standard 30-inch OTR replacement?
No. This unit is 20 inches wide and will not fit a standard 30-inch over-the-range mounting space. It is designed for compact kitchens or ranges that are narrower than the standard 30-inch configuration. If you have a standard 30-inch range, look at Frigidaire's FFMV1846VS instead.
How much faster does 1500W heat food compared to a 1000W microwave?
A 1500W microwave delivers 50% more power than a 1000W unit. In practice, a task that takes 2 minutes at 1000W takes roughly 80 seconds at 1500W. The time savings are most noticeable for larger volumes of food or dense items like potatoes or frozen meals.
